New Titles Added to Book Contest Pick List for April 2015

minimum height spacer

If it has been a while since you looked through my list of titles available as part of the monthly Book Drawing contest, now would be a good time since four new books were just added. Thanks to the generosity of publishers like Artech House, Cambridge University Press, and McGraw Hill, I have been able to offer a book or two every month to RF Cafe visitors who have entered via a simple process. To date, about 120 books have been given away. Not only are the books made available for free, but I have personally paid for postage on all of them - even the many shipped to overseas winners. These books typically carry a retail price of well over $100, and they are of course of very recent publication since I receive them from the publishers to review often times prior to when they are available publicly. When the subjects and content are conductive to it, I create 10-question quizzes based on the material. A lot of people have missed out on a free book over the years due to not responding to my e-mails notifying them of having won, so if you know you have qualified as a potential winner in the last month or two, be sure to check your inbox or maybe even spam folder for an email from kmblatt83@aol.com.
